Tomato Varieties And Their Impact On Flavor

The choice of tomato varieties plays a crucial role in shaping the flavor of ketchup. Different types of tomatoes contain varying levels of sugars, acids, and volatile compounds, all of which contribute to the overall taste profile of the final product. For instance, certain heirloom tomato varieties are known for their higher sugar content, which can result in a sweeter and more flavorful ketchup. In contrast, some modern hybrid varieties may have been bred for qualities such as acidity or firmness, affecting the balance of sweetness and tartness in the ketchup.

Moreover, the size and ripeness of the tomatoes at harvest also influence the flavor of ketchup. Riper tomatoes tend to be sweeter due to increased sugar levels, leading to a richer and more intense taste in the finished ketchup. Additionally, the processing techniques used to turn the tomatoes into ketchup can further amplify or modify the inherent flavors of the chosen tomato varieties. By carefully selecting and managing the tomato varieties used, ketchup manufacturers can fine-tune the sweet taste and overall flavor profile of their products to meet consumer preferences.

The Effects Of High Fructose Corn Syrup

High fructose corn syrup (HFCS) is a common sweetener used in ketchup and other processed foods. Its high fructose content gives ketchup its sweet taste. However, there is growing concern about the health effects of consuming HFCS. Research has suggested that excessive consumption of HFCS may contribute to obesity, type 2 diabetes, and other metabolic problems. Additionally, HFCS has been linked to increased levels of triglycerides, leading to potential cardiovascular risks.

Furthermore, the way HFCS is metabolized in the body may lead to a higher preference for sweet foods and increased calorie intake, which can contribute to weight gain. These effects underscore the need for moderation in consuming foods containing high fructose corn syrup. As consumers become more aware of the potential health risks associated with HFCS, food manufacturers have started to explore alternative sweeteners for their products, with some opting for natural sweeteners like honey or maple syrup in an effort to offer healthier options for consumers.

Alternatives To Traditional Ketchup Sweeteners

In recent years, consumers have become increasingly health-conscious, leading to a demand for alternatives to traditional ketchup sweeteners. As a result, food manufacturers have been exploring natural sweeteners such as honey, maple syrup, and agave nectar to replace high fructose corn syrup and refined sugars in ketchup formulations. These alternatives offer a more nuanced and complex sweetness, adding depth of flavor to the condiment.

Furthermore, some companies are developing innovative versions of ketchup using fruits like apples, berries, and dates as natural sweeteners. These options not only provide a different taste profile but also introduce additional nutrients and antioxidants. Stevia, a plant-based sweetener with zero calories, is also being used in some ketchup formulations to cater to the needs of health-conscious consumers who want to reduce their sugar intake. Overall, as the demand for healthier food options continues to grow, the quest for alternative sweeteners in ketchup is likely to expand, offering consumers a broader range of choices to suit their dietary preferences.
